How to Become a Brickmasons and Blockmasons in District of Columbia
Brickmasons and Blockmasons in District of Columbia earn a median salary of $64,100/year, which is 5% above the national average. District of Columbia has a state income tax of ~4.4%. After taxes and rent, a brickmasons and blockmasons takes home approximately $2,810/month. Most positions require High school diploma or equivalent.

How much does a brickmasons and blockmasons make in District of Columbia?▼
The median brickmasons and blockmasons salary in District of Columbia is $64,100 per year ($30.82/hr). This is 5% above the national median of $60,800. Salaries range from $62,740 to $91,590.

Can a brickmasons and blockmasons afford to live in District of Columbia?▼
At the median salary of $64,100, a brickmasons and blockmasons in District of Columbia would take home approximately $4,222/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 33.4%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.
